Can yellowed lace be whitened?

If you are lucky enough to have some vintage pieces, you may find that they have yellowed and become stained through the years. The safest way to whiten and brighten lace is to use an oxygen-based bleach. … Add your lace pieces and allow to soak for at least two hours, overnight is best.

Will vinegar clean lace curtains?

If regular hand-washing doesn’t remove discoloration from your lace curtains, mix 1/4 cup of white vinegar or lemon juice into 1 cup of distilled water. Spread the curtain flat and dab the solution on the stained area using a clean cloth. Let the curtain sit for 10-15 minutes before rinsing with cool water.

How do you clean a yellow wedding veil?

Soak the veil in a lemon juice solution. Mix in a tablespoon of lemon juice to one cup of water. Make enough solution to immerse the veil, and then gently wash it. The acid in the solution is strong enough to repel any odour while eliminating mildew growth.

How do you whiten yellowed polyester curtains?

Dissolve ½ cup of electric dish washing detergent into the hot water. Stir well until dissolved. Place curtains into the mixture, pushing down so that they are completely submerged. Allow them to soak for 8 to 24 hours, depending on how yellow they are.

How do you get yellow out of linen?

To remove the stains, the best option is to use a hydrogen peroxide-based cleaner, according to The Stain Expert website. Various stain removers, such as OxiClean, are primarily made with hydrogen peroxide. Before treating the linen, you should soak the fabric in soap or detergent.

How do you get the yellow out of a white dress?

The most gentle method to whiten washable clothes is to mix a solution of warm water and oxygen-based bleach. Follow the package recommendations as to how much to use per gallon of water. Submerge the white garments and allow them to soak at least eight hours or overnight. Patience is required.

Can you use OxiClean on linen?

Pre-soak your linens with OxiClean powder and water mixture for tougher stains. Use one to four scoops of OxiClean powder to 1 gallon of hot or warm water, making sure the powder is completely dissolved. Leave linens soaking for one to six hours.

Why is my lace yellow?

Bleach is hazardous to lace because the harsh chemicals eat away at the fibers while they whiten them. … When it oxidizes, it eats away at both. For many antique fabrics and fibers, this chemical reaction means that they will turn a deep yellow color, which is often times irreversible.
